A Thin Film Black Phosphorus Light-Emitting Diode
We demonstrate a black phosphorus light-emitting diode based on a black phosphorus/molybdenum disulfide heterostructure. The device shows an electroluminescence maximum at a wavelength of 3.68 μm with an internal quantum efficiency of ∼1%.
